The Rest Of Asia Pacific Structural Heart Devices Market was valued at $169.8 Million in 2024 and projected to reach to $274.9 Million by 2029, representing a compound annual growth rate of 10.1%. Rest Of Asia Pacific represents a high-growth opportunity within the broader Asia Pacific structural heart devices landscape.

    Market Definition

    Structural Heart devices are used to treat conditions such as aortic valve disease, mitral valve disease, atrial septal defect, ventricular septal defect, hypertrophic cardiomyopathy, and tricuspid and pulmonic valve disease. Structural heart devices can be used to close holes in the heart, open narrowed heart valves, or replace damaged valves.
